Model name of the 400V class ends with H.

The permissible voltage imbalance ratio is 3% or less. (Imbalance ratio = (highest voltage between lines - average voltage between three lines) / average
voltage between three lines  100).

DC output capacity when the input voltage is 200VAC (400V for the 400V class).

Change the MC power supply stepdown transformer tap according to the input voltage. (Refer to the Instruction Manual)

The % value of the overload current rating indicates the ratio of the overload current to the converter's rated input current. For repeated duty, allow time for
the converter and the inverter to return to or below the temperatures under 100% load.

The protective structure is IP40 for FR-DU07-CNV (except the PU connector) and IP00 for the outside box (220K or lower) and the reactor regardless of
their capacities.

When the hook of the converter front cover is cut off for installation of the plug-in option, the protective structure changes to the open type (IP00).

Mass of FR-HC2 alone.
